About
Contact
Privacy Policy
Terms And Conditions
HOME
Business
Science
Technology
World
HOME
Business
Science
Technology
World
Tag - planetary science
Science
Watch Four Planets Orbit One Star 130 Light Years Away
Science
NASA postpones Venus mission due to problems at JPL
Science
Telescope Reveals Huge Debris Trail from NASA’s...